KRO campaigns to keep BBC crime showsTuesday 28 August 2007 TV stataion KRO has launched a petition on its website to keep the BBC series Dalziel & Pascoe and The Inspector Lynley Mysteries which it has been broadcasting for several years. The BBC wants to stop making the programmes. Fans can register their signature at www.detectives.kro.nl © DutchNews.nl Get the DutchNews.nl newsletter in your mailbox: Click here to subscribe
